What to Expect on the Little Boracay Batangas Day Tour
This tour kicks off with a convenient pickup in Metro Manila, which includes a vehicle, driver, tolls, fuel, parking, and the assurance that you won’t need to stress about transportation logistics. The journey itself is part of the experience—comfortable, air-conditioned, and designed to get you to Batangas efficiently.
The Morning: Breakfast and First Impressions
Your first stop is in Calatagan, where you’ll enjoy a breakfast around an hour after departure. This sets the tone for the day—light, fresh, and an opportunity to fuel up for the adventures ahead. Many reviews mention the ease of pickup and the smooth start, making the whole process feel well-organized.
Little Boracay Floating Cottage Rentals: Snorkeling and Swimming
The highlight of the day is at the Little Boracay Floating Cottage Rentals, where you’ll spend around three hours enjoying water activities. The highlight here is snorkeling over vibrant coral reefs teeming with marine life, offering a glimpse into the colorful underwater world. Reviewers have described it as “ mesmerizing” and “a perfect spot for underwater photography.”
Aside from snorkeling, you’re free to swim, relax on the floating cottages, or simply bask in the sun. The soft sands and clear waters make it an ideal place for a quick dip, with life vests provided for safety. Many guests appreciate that the tour includes a mini dressing room—a small but thoughtful addition for changing into swimwear or drying off.

Starfish Sandbar: Scenic Fun and Sunset Views
The afternoon takes you to the Starfish Sandbar, a shallow shoal accessible at low tide. Here, the sight of starfish and other marine creatures adds a charming touch to the visit. You’ll spend about three hours sightseeing and swimming, with plenty of opportunities for photos and quiet moments.
Guests often describe the view of the horizon during late afternoon as breathtaking, perfect for quiet reflection or capturing stunning sunset photos. The sandbar’s calm waters are also ideal for water activities like paddleboarding or kayaking, which are available if you seek a bit more adventure.
End of the Day: Return to Manila
As the sun sets, the tour concludes with a return to Metro Manila, ensuring you arrive comfortably and on time. The entire experience is designed for convenience, leaving little to chance, which many travelers find reassuring.
The Value of the Tour: Breaking Down What You Get
At $403 for a group of up to three, this tour offers a lot of value for those seeking a guided, all-inclusive day trip. Everything from transportation, guide, and boatman to floating cottages and snorkeling gear is covered, saving you the hassle of coordinating multiple vendors or worrying about hidden costs.
The inclusion of pickup and drop-off anywhere in Metro Manila is a big plus, especially for travelers staying in central hotels. The one-hour free waiting time at pickup points helps accommodate delays, though additional overtime will cost PHP350/hr if needed. This flexibility is useful if your plans change unexpectedly.
While the price doesn’t include personal expenses, meals, entrance fees, or snorkeling gear, these are relatively minor costs considering the comprehensive nature of the tour. The free use of a griller and life vests are thoughtful touches that add to the experience.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is included in the tour price?
The price covers vehicle transportation, driver, toll fees, fuel, parking, boatman, floating cottage, guide, mini dressing room, free griller use, and life vests.
Are meals included?
Yes, the tour includes a breakfast at Calatagan and a one-hour lunch at the floating cottages.
Can I bring my own snorkeling gear?
Snorkeling gear is not explicitly included but is available for use during the tour, so you might find it convenient to bring your own if you prefer.
How long is the tour?
The entire experience lasts around 8 hours, with specific stops for activities and meals.
Is this tour suitable for children?
Yes, the shallow waters and calm environment at the sandbar make it suitable for kids, especially with life vests provided.
What about the sunset?
The late afternoon gives you a chance to enjoy a breathtaking sunset over the horizon, ideal for photos and quiet moments.
Is the tour private?
Yes, it’s arranged for private groups, which means more personalized attention and a more intimate experience.
What should I bring?
Bring swimwear, towels, sun protection, and possibly waterproof cameras. The tour provides basic gear and amenities.
What if I want to extend the day?
Overtime fees of PHP350/hr apply if you wish to stay longer beyond the scheduled stops.
How do I cancel?
You can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, making it flexible should plans change.
